BudgetApp

Created with vanilla javascript and the CSS framework, Bulma. This app allows the user to enter in expenses based on monthly or yearly expenses. Another great feature is that the app will countdown to the next pay day and reset your biweekly budget when the next pay day arrives. Please enjoy the app and feel free to contribute any comments, questions, features or hotfixes.

Future Features

  • Multiple options for time frames when setting up the budget initially.
  • Over/under budget to be factored in and updated once the pay day arrives.
  • Alert when you're close to going below budget.
  • Optional description input for tracking.
  • Detailed reports of expenses being tracked.
